BBC News - UK Gamers Spend £1.5bn on titles
Thursday, 20 December 2007, 10:07 GMT

With just two weeks of shopping time left for 2007, gamers have managed to send a record breaking £1.5bn on games and with the last week alone, £87.9bn was spent on games. This is a 25% increase on the total games sold in 2006. According to the article games account for almost 80% of all software sales world wide.

BBC News - Greenpeace calls on Gaming Giants
Wednesday, 12 December 2007, 14:57 GMT

It had to happen at some point, with their approach to saving the world, Greenpeace is now targeting the gaming industry. Besides games turning the players into green-footprint emitters, Greenpeace now wants the consoles to become more environmentally friendly by phasing out the introduction of the most dangerous chemicals in its machines.
